Clay-based litters are popular for their excellent absorbency, which assists in managing smells effectively. They are simple to scoop and maintain, making them a convenient choice for lots of feline owners.

Another option gaining appeal is clumping litter, known for its capability to form tight clumps when wet. This feature simplifies cleansing as you can easily scoop out the clumps, leaving the remainder of the litter clean and fresh. Clumping litters also tend to last longer in between changes, which can be more cost-effective in the long run despite their greater initial cost compared to conventional clay litters.

Silica gel litter is a newer development in the market, valued for its high absorbency and excellent smell control homes. This kind of litter often can be found in the kind of crystals that trap moisture successfully, decreasing the development of odors. Numerous feline owners find silica gel litter to be less dirty than other types, contributing to a cleaner environment for both felines and their owners.

Natural and biodegradable litters have also gotten traction among environmentally-conscious feline owners. Made from products such as pine, wheat, or recycled paper, these litters offer an environmentally friendly option to traditional options. They are frequently complimentary from ingredients and chemicals, making them safer for both felines and human beings alike. While natural litters may need more frequent changing compared to clay or clumping litters, their sustainability appeal makes them a preferred choice for lots of households.

The depth of litter in package is another essential consideration. Felines normally prefer a depth of litter that allows them to dig and cover their waste easily. It's suggested to maintain a depth of litter in between 2-3 inches, guaranteeing adequate protection and absorption of liquids. Routinely scooping out waste and topping up litter as required helps keep tidiness and freshness, encouraging your feline to continue using the litter box regularly.

Maintaining cleanliness is essential to ensuring your feline's satisfaction with their litter box. Routinely digging waste at least as soon as a day, if not more often, avoids odors from developing up and keeps the litter box tidy. Depending upon the kind of litter used, it's suggested to completely change the litter and tidy the box itself every 1-2 weeks to avoid bacterial growth and preserve health.

Introducing your cat to a new litter or litter box should be done slowly to prevent stress and resistance. If changing to a different kind of litter, mix percentages of the brand-new litter with the old over numerous days to permit your cat to adjust to the change. Likewise, if introducing a new litter box, place it together with the existing one at first to offer your feline time to check out and adjust at their own speed.

The size and design of the litter box also impact your cat's comfort and ease of usage. Pick a litter box that is big enough for your feline to conveniently reverse in which has low sides for simple entry, particularly for kittycats or senior felines with movement concerns. Some litter boxes come with hoods or covers, which can provide privacy and help consist of litter scatter, though not all felines might value enclosed spaces.

Correct disposal of used litter is important for hygiene and smell control. Dispose of clumps and strong waste in a safely connected plastic bag and location it in your home garbage. Avoid flushing litter down the toilet unless it is specifically identified as flushable, as many kinds of litter can trigger plumbing issues and environmental issues.

If you have several felines, offering each cat with their own litter box can help avoid territorial conflicts and make sure each cat has simple access to a clean space. Location litter boxes in various areas throughout your home to accommodate each feline's choices and reduce competition for resources.

Routinely examining and cleaning the litter box itself is important for maintaining health. Use mild, odorless soap and warm water to scrub the litter box, preventing extreme chemicals that might leave residues damaging to your feline. Permit the litter box to dry totally before refilling it with fresh litter to prevent mold and bacterial growth.
